Index: Source/devtools/front_end/sdk/CSSMetadata.js |
diff --git a/Source/devtools/front_end/sdk/CSSMetadata.js b/Source/devtools/front_end/sdk/CSSMetadata.js |
index d43d57d73e9516306c4899f2dd77ad53d8702945..10e516a1947ab994a5835cad80d2768791dd47b7 100644 |
--- a/Source/devtools/front_end/sdk/CSSMetadata.js |
+++ b/Source/devtools/front_end/sdk/CSSMetadata.js |
@@ -76,7 +76,7 @@ WebInspector.CSSMetadata.cssPropertiesMetainfo = new WebInspector.CSSMetadata([] |
*/ |
WebInspector.CSSMetadata.isColorAwareProperty = function(propertyName) |
{ |
- return WebInspector.CSSMetadata._colorAwareProperties[propertyName] === true; |
+ return WebInspector.CSSMetadata._colorAwareProperties[propertyName.toLowerCase()] === true; |
vivekg
2014/07/08 11:03:37
This enables the swatch in non-case sensitive way.
apavlov
2014/07/08 11:16:37
Generally, we should never compare to boolean lite
|
} |
/** |
@@ -724,10 +724,10 @@ WebInspector.CSSMetadata._propertyDataMap = { |
WebInspector.CSSMetadata.keywordsForProperty = function(propertyName) |
{ |
var acceptedKeywords = ["inherit", "initial"]; |
- var descriptor = WebInspector.CSSMetadata.descriptor(propertyName); |
+ var descriptor = WebInspector.CSSMetadata.descriptor(propertyName.toLowerCase()); |
apavlov
2014/07/08 11:16:37
This conversion should be done inside WebInspector
|
if (descriptor && descriptor.values) |
acceptedKeywords.push.apply(acceptedKeywords, descriptor.values); |
- if (propertyName in WebInspector.CSSMetadata._colorAwareProperties) |
+ if (propertyName.toLowerCase() in WebInspector.CSSMetadata._colorAwareProperties) |
vivekg
2014/07/08 11:03:37
This change enables the suggestion keywords for th
apavlov
2014/07/08 11:16:37
Hmm, in fact, this does exactly the same as WebIns
|
acceptedKeywords.push.apply(acceptedKeywords, WebInspector.CSSMetadata._colors); |
return new WebInspector.CSSMetadata(acceptedKeywords); |
} |